Euro 2020: Romelu Lukaku helps Belgium run over Russia; Wales hold Switzerland

Saint Petersberg: Romelu Lukaku scored a brace as Belgium ran riot against Russia 3-0 in the Euro 2020 encounter on Saturday. Lukaku scored once in each half to keep his Inter Milan form intact.

Thomas Meunier scored the other for Belgium as the Red Devils started their campaign in the best way possible barring the injury to Timothy Castagne after a horrible collision with Daler Kuzyaev.

Lukaku who is Christian Eriksen’s teammate at Inter dedicated his goals to his Denmark counterpart after the latter collapsed on the pitch mid-match in Copenhagen and had to be given CPR to be revived. For Lukaku and the entire football community, it was highly emotional and difficult for the show to go on.

Elsewhere, Wales played a 1-1 draw against Switzerland. Breel Embolo gave his Swiss the lead in the 49th minute from a header before a 74th-minute goal from Kieffer Moore saw both teams from Group A share the points.
